Pros: It was a very clean and well-kept property. I loved that there was a bathroom off of each of the bedrooms, and an outside bathroom by the pool. The beds and furniture were pretty comfortable. The pool and spa were used and enjoyed daily (the pool man came on Tuesday morning). I also really enjoyed the large bathtub and shower room. The location was great, it was in a quiet neighborhood away from busy roads which made for a peaceful stay. Stores were about 15 minutes away (Walmart, Target, Publix) and beaches about an hour away (we went to Ft. Myers and Venice Beach). The sunsets over the water were absolutely beautiful to watch every night on the lanai. The host/owner as well as the property managers were easy to contact and pleasant to interact with. Check-in and check-out were easy and quick, Adam did both for us and he was really nice. (Note: When they show you how to control the pool/spa area, I recommend writing things down or taking a video as a point of reference). This was our first experience renting a house for vacation, and it was a good one overall.
Cons: The Wifi was out for most of our stay, but it did work well the few times it was up and running. But something I feel should be made known is that you cannot stream any type of video over the Wifi (the location of the house is in an area without a good connection, so only music streaming and internet surfing are allowed. No YouTube, Netflix, Amazon, etc. There is a way to do something with a sim card that would allow you to stream these services, but I'm not that technically advanced so we didn't attempt to do this.) This was probably the biggest negative for our family because I had planned on using Zoom to get some work done while there, and we had even brought our Roku so my grandpa could watch TV while the rest of us did other things (he has health issues so his ability to do stuff is limited.) The TVs do have cable so it's not like you're left without anything, I enjoyed watching re-runs of the Office and some movies. We tried to use our phone data, but our service inside the house was terrible (Boost Mobile). Perhaps other networks would give you better coverage, I'm not sure. However, if streaming isn't a huge concern for you, this really is a nice sort of off-the-grid oasis for people to enjoy. Two more things: Trash ran Thursday morning instead of Friday as the paperwork said, and the blinds in the two pool-view bedrooms need to be fixed, they don't close properly.
